Description
The QH-GZ Zero-tailing Laser Tube Cutting Machine, integrated with Weldseam Identification Technology and a Side-mounted Lathe, is a high-precision, low-waste tube processing solution tailored for automotive components, hydraulic systems, and mechanical engineering. Its defining features—weldseam identification and zero-tailing—work in synergy with the side-mounted lathe to redefine tube cutting efficiency and accuracy:
The weldseam identification system automatically detects and locates weld seams on round (Φ15-500mm) and square (15×15-500×500mm) tubes, ensuring cuts avoid seam areas (critical for structural integrity) and align with optimal material sections. Paired with this, the zero-tailing technology limits residual tube length to ≤5mm per cut, drastically reducing material waste—especially for high-value metals like stainless steel. Supported by the side-mounted lathe, which stabilizes tubes of 5500-6500mm length during processing, the machine maintains ±0.03mm X/Y-axis positioning and repositioning accuracy, delivering consistent, burr-free cuts across tube types. Equipped with a 1500W-20KW laser power range, it handles diverse tube thicknesses in one pass, while its 2T weight and 9620×2950×2080mm dimensions balance industrial robustness with workshop space adaptability for medium-scale production.

Product Specifications
Model QH-GZ
Cutting Diameter Round Tube: Φ15-500mm
Square Tube: 15*15mm to 500*500mm
Tube Length Capacity 5500-6500mm
Machine Weight 2T
Dimensions (L*W*H) 9620*2950*2080mm
Laser Power Range 1500W-20KW
Positioning Accuracy ±0.03mm (X/Y-axis)
Repositioning Accuracy ±0.03mm (X/Y-axis)
Compatible Tube Types Round Tube / Square Tube
